Happy New Year to all! We had so many 1sts this last year. We moved to Georgia, we added mom and sis to our home, we added Gus, my new job, her retirement. We bought another (larger) AS.

In restrospect, I wish I had gotten out of my truck with my camera when we were bringing our 31' home and got stuck on our driveway. That would have been a pic. At 12:15am, we rounded the curve in the driveway to go up, but I couldn't make it. The tires spun on the gravel, the rear of the AS dragged and we stopped. I surveyed our position, then backed down the hill into the neighbors drive then gunned it back up. Here is the first pic at home in the driveway. It means something to me...after driving from Ocala FL to finally make it home, then get stuck in the driveway after midnight.

Found a picture of our first camping trip in our "new" 1978 Argosy. It was a disaster as we lost most of the running lights on the way there (I had washed the trailer really, really well and loosened them) and the AC quit working our first night. We were still excited about actually having an Argosy because we knew there was nothing that couldn't be fixed on an Airstream. Take a close look and you will see that running light is gone.

Talk about new beginnings...if you truely have aluminitis this will bring a tear to your eye.

For the first time since I've owned her "Old Paint" is sleeping inside. Tonight I parked the Argosy in our new barn! I took a lousy picture with my camera phone so to make it more interesting I tweeked it in Photoshop.

We closed on this property a few weeks ago and although the barn isn't as clean inside as I wanted it to be we are expecting rain and snow so I figured I'd get the TT out of the weather. This dream property is just what I've been looking for: A fixer-upper that we could afford, more room inside and out, and with out buildings

Gotta add us to the courtesy parking list next...15 minutes off I-80 and 90 West of Cleveland.
